In the Message;
Subject : [opensuse-ja] rpmbuild のディレクトリ指定は?
Message-ID : <87tv1uyvc9.wl-nomiya@galaxy.dti.ne.jp>
Date & Time: Wed, 08 Apr 2020 22:12:54 +0900
[MN] == 野宮 賢 / NOMIYA Masaru has written:
[...]
MN> ERROR: Can't hardlink file:
MN> /tmp/LibreOffice//replace_file/lang_117_id_4ae1d939/00/main.xcd ->
MN> /home/masaru/rpmbuild/BUILDROOT/libreoffice-6.4.2.2-lp151.904.3.x86_64/usr/lib64/libreoffice/share/registry/main.xcd
MN> Invalid cross-device link at
MN> /home/masaru/rpmbuild/BUILD/libreoffice-6.4.2.2/solenv/bin/modules/installer/worker.pm
MN> line 347.
MN> というエラーで Abend されます.
MN> これは、user でビルドすると $HOME/rpmbuild 配下で進捗するのですが、最
MN> 後の段階で tmp ファイルが、/tmp デイレクトリに作成されるために生じるエ
MN> ラーであることは解ります.が、$HOME と同じパーティションに tmp ファイ
MN> ルを作成させるディレクトリの指定方法が解りません.
MN> どのようなオプションを rpmbuild に付ければ良いのでしょうか?
解ったような気がしています.
オプションでは無く、~/.rpmmacros の作成ですね.
---
┏━━┓彡 野宮 賢 mail-to: nomiya @ galaxy.dti.ne.jp
┃\/彡
┗━━┛ 「決して,道具になりさえすればよいから,理論的なことはどうでもよい,
ということにはならない.」
-- 森 毅 --
--
To unsubscribe, e-mail: opensuse-ja+unsubscribe@opensuse.org
To contact the owner, e-mail: opensuse-ja+owner@opensuse.org